For West Texas, avoid organic-rich topsoil and use clean, compactable fill — preferably sandy or silty sand fill with low organic content. Where drainage is important, blend or cap the fill with coarse sand, gravel, or a 3/4" crushed stone layer and add geotextile fabric to separate fines from drainage layers. For structural or foundation work, ask for engineered or select fill that meets compaction requirements; for landscaping, a sandy fill topped with gravel improves drainage.
Volume needed is about 12.3 cubic yards for 1,000 sq ft raised 4 inches (1000 * 4/12 / 27). Using a practical conversion range of 1.2 to 1.3 tons per cubic yard, expect roughly 15 to 16 tons of loose fill dirt, with a safe ordering range of 14 to 18 tons to allow for compaction and settlement. Always round up slightly and consult your supplier about loose vs compacted weight.
Permit rules vary by city, county, and neighborhood; McNeil area work is typically governed by your city or Travis County permitting office and any HOA rules. Small yard fills often do not require a permit, but grading that changes drainage, affects floodplains, or moves large volumes commonly does. Before ordering, contact your local permitting office and review HOA covenants to confirm permit, erosion control, and inspection requirements.
A driveway built only of fill dirt will perform poorly in McNeil's climate — it tends to rut, dust, and erode with rain. For lasting performance, place a well-compacted road base or crushed limestone over the fill, with 6 to 8 inches of compacted structural material for typical residential driveways. Expect periodic maintenance such as regrading or adding material after heavy storms, typically every 1 to 3 years depending on traffic and drainage.
Fill dirt is best used as bulk structural fill or to raise grade; it is not an ideal finished surface. Crushed limestone provides a good finished surface in many Central Texas yards and drives, offering drainage and compaction, while road base (engineered aggregate with fines) is the preferred load-bearing layer under driveways and paving. For durable driveways, use compacted road base topped with crushed limestone or a wearing surface.

Direct runoff away from structures by maintaining positive grades, install swales or terraces on steeper slopes, and use erosion-control measures like geotextile fabric, straw or erosion blankets, rock riprap at outlets, and prompt vegetation or hydroseed. For steeper or high-flow areas, a retaining wall, terraces, and reinforced channels are often necessary to prevent washouts. Check local stormwater rules before altering grades, since changes that increase runoff onto neighbors can trigger permitting or remediation.
Place fill in lifts (layers) no thicker than 6 to 8 inches loose, then compact each lift; for small residential areas use a vibrating plate compactor or walk-behind roller, and for larger fills use a vibratory drum or sheep's-foot roller. For structural or foundation fills, aim for compaction targets (often 90% or higher of Standard Proctor) and control moisture content during placement. If the project is structural, have compaction tested by a soils engineer and follow any engineered fill specifications.
